<%@ page import="java.sql.*" %> <%@ page import="java.util.*" %> <%@ page import="gov.globe.tg.*" %> <%@ page import="org.apache.torque.Torque" %> <% String reg = null; String regparam = request.getParameter("rg"); if (regparam == null) { regparam = (String) session.getAttribute("sessionrg"); } else { session.setAttribute("sessionrg", regparam); } if (regparam == null || "".equals(regparam) || "n".equals(regparam)) { reg = ""; //DEFINE regparam so we can pass it along to goddard et al. regparam = "n"; } else { reg = "/reg"; } String lang = request.getParameter ("lang"); if (lang == null){ Cookie[] cookies = request.getCookies(); if (cookies != null){ for (int i=0; i < cookies.length; i++){ if (cookies[i].getName().equals("language")){ lang = cookies[i].getValue(); break; } } } if (lang == null){ lang = "en"; } } else { Cookie cookie = new Cookie("language", lang); response.addCookie(cookie); } // Set the content type appropriately depending on which language the user chose if (lang.equals ("ru") ) { response.setContentType ("text/html; charset=windows-1251"); } else if ( lang.equals ("ar") ) { response.setContentType ("text/html; charset=Windows-1256"); } else if (lang.equals ("jp")) { response.setContentType ("text/html; charset=Shift_JIS"); } else { response.setContentType ("text/html; charset=iso-8859-1"); } Connection conn = null; Statement stmt = null; conn = Torque.getConnection("globe-tg"); Map ht = new HashMap(); try { stmt = conn.createStatement(); String [] tokensArray = {"Nav_HomeLogo","Nav_HowToJoin", "Nav_ScienceAndEducation", "Nav_TeachersGuide", "Nav_Measurements", "Nav_Investigations", "Nav_SchoolCollaboration", "Nav_ScientistsCorner", "Nav_EducatorsCorner", "Nav_Data", "Nav_DataEntry", "Nav_Visualizations", "Nav_DataArchive", "Nav_Partners", "Nav_PartnerCountries", "Nav_SchoolSearch", "Nav_Franchises", "Nav_Agencies", "Nav_Library", "Nav_ResourceRoom", "Nav_Stars", "Nav_NewsAndEvents", "Nav_InfoAndHelp", "LearnAboutGLOBE", "Nav_HelpDesk", "Nav_FAQ", "Nav_PartnerSupport" , "Nav_SiteSearch", "QuesComm", "Accessibility", "Privacy", "ServerLoc"} ; String query; ResultSet rs; for (int i=0; i
<%= ht.get ("Nav_HomeLogo") %>
<%= ht.get ("Nav_HowToJoin") %>
<%= ht.get ( "Nav_ScienceAndEducation") %>
<%= ht.get ("Nav_TeachersGuide") %>
<%= ht.get ( "Nav_Measurements") %>
<%= ht.get ("Nav_Investigations") %>
<%= ht.get("Nav_SchoolCollaboration") %>
<%= ht.get ( "Nav_ScientistsCorner") %>
<%= ht.get ("Nav_EducatorsCorner") %>

<%= ht.get("Nav_Data") %>
<%= ht.get ("Nav_DataEntry") %>
<%= ht.get ("Nav_Visualizations") %>
<%= ht.get ( "Nav_DataArchive") %>

<%= ht.get ("Nav_Partners") %>
<%= ht.get ("Nav_PartnerCountries") %>
<%= ht.get ("Nav_SchoolSearch") %>
<%= ht.get ( "Nav_Franchises") %>
<%= ht.get ("Nav_Agencies") %>

<%= ht.get ("Nav_Library") %>
<%= ht.get ("Nav_ResourceRoom") %>
<%= ht.get ("Nav_Stars") %>
<%= ht.get ("Nav_NewsAndEvents") %>

<%= ht.get ( "Nav_InfoAndHelp") %>
<%= ht.get ("LearnAboutGLOBE") %>
"><%= ht.get ("Nav_HelpDesk") %>
"><%= ht.get ("Nav_FAQ") %>
<%= ht.get ("Nav_PartnerSupport") %>

<%= ht.get ("Nav_SiteSearch") %>
<% String partialURL= request.getRequestURI() + "?lang=" ; String englishURL = partialURL + "en"; String spanishURL = partialURL + "es"; String frenchURL = partialURL + "fr"; String russianURL = partialURL + "ru"; String germanURL = partialURL + "de"; String nederlandsURL = partialURL + "nl"; String arabicURL = partialURL + "ar"; // String japaneseURL = partialURL + "jp"; String englishImage = "images/lang_en_off.gif"; String spanishImage = "images/lang_es_off.gif"; String frenchImage = "images/lang_fr_off.gif"; String russianImage = "images/lang_ru_off.gif"; String germanImage = "images/lang_de_off.gif"; String nederlandsImage = "images/lang_nl_off.gif"; String arabicImage = "images/lang_ar_off.gif"; // String japaneseImage if (lang.equals("en")){ englishImage = "images/lang_en_on.gif"; } else if (lang.equals("es")){ spanishImage = "images/lang_es_on.gif"; } else if (lang.equals("fr")){ frenchImage = "images/lang_fr_on.gif"; } else if (lang.equals("ru")){ russianImage = "images/lang_ru_on.gif"; } else if (lang.equals("de")){ germanImage = "images/lang_de_on.gif"; } else if (lang.equals("nl")){ nederlandsImage = "images/lang_nl_on.gif"; } else if (lang.equals("ar")){ arabicImage = "images/lang_ar_on.gif"; } %> <%-- --%>
>English >Spanish >French >Russian >German >Netherlands >Arabic >Japanese

<%= ht.get ("ServerLoc") %>: [US] [Germany] ">

<%= ht.get ("QuesComm") %>
GLOBE is supported by NASA, NSF, EPA and the US Dept. of State. [<%= ht.get ("Privacy") %>] [<%= ht.get ("Accessibility") %>]